Sat 796667428274944

decimal
159333.2428274944
degree
0°159333′69″2428274944‴
percentile
37.93654424529898%
name
ifaehsgderx
cycle
0
epoch
0
period
79
block
159333
offset
2428274944
timestamp
rarity
common